Elements within the matrix are of small size

Post by NELLLY »

Hi
I have the following matrix

Code: Select all

\[ P^{(t)}=P^t
=\bordermatrix[{[]}]{ \displaystyle
 &1&2\cr
1&\frac{b+(1-a)(a-b)^t}{1-a+b}&\frac{(1-a)-(1-a)(a-b)^t}{1-a+b}\cr
2&\frac{b-b(a-b)^t}{1-a+b}&\frac{(1-a)+b(a-b)^t}{1-a+b}}\label{Pt}\]
The problem is that the elements within the matrix are of small size. I used \diplaystyle but the problem still remain. What can I do?

Hi,

use \dfrac instead of \frac, as the following example suggests:

Code: Select all

\documentclass[11pt,a4paper]{book}
\usepackage{amsmath}

\makeatletter
\newif\if@borderstar
   \def\bordermatrix{\@ifnextchar*{%
       \@borderstartrue\@bordermatrix@i}{\@borderstarfalse\@bordermatrix@i*}%
   }
   \def\@bordermatrix@i*{\@ifnextchar[{\@bordermatrix@ii}{\@bordermatrix@ii[()]}}
   \def\@bordermatrix@ii[#1]#2{%
   \begingroup
     \m@th\@tempdima8.75\p@\setbox\z@\vbox{%
       \def\cr{\crcr\noalign{\kern 2\p@\global\let\cr\endline }}%
       \ialign {$##$\hfil\kern 2\p@\kern\@tempdima & \thinspace %
       \hfil $##$\hfil && \quad\hfil $##$\hfil\crcr\omit\strut %
       \hfil\crcr\noalign{\kern -\baselineskip}#2\crcr\omit %
       \strut\cr}}%
     \setbox\tw@\vbox{\unvcopy\z@\global\setbox\@ne\lastbox}%
     \setbox\tw@\hbox{\unhbox\@ne\unskip\global\setbox\@ne\lastbox}%
     \setbox\tw@\hbox{%
       $\kern\wd\@ne\kern -\@tempdima\left\@firstoftwo#1%
         \if@borderstar\kern2pt\else\kern -\wd\@ne\fi%
       \global\setbox\@ne\vbox{\box\@ne\if@borderstar\else\kern 2\p@\fi}%
       \vcenter{\if@borderstar\else\kern -\ht\@ne\fi%
         \unvbox\z@\kern-\if@borderstar2\fi\baselineskip}%
         \if@borderstar\kern-2\@tempdima\kern2\p@\else\,\fi\right\@secondoftwo#1 $%
     }\null \;\vbox{\kern\ht\@ne\box\tw@}%
   \endgroup
   }
\makeatother

\begin{document}

\begin{equation}\label{Pt}
  P^{(t)} = P^t = 
  \bordermatrix[{[]}]{ 
    &1&2\cr
    1&\dfrac{b+(1-a)(a-b)^t}{1-a+b}&\dfrac{(1-a)-(1-a)(a-b)^t}{1-a+b}\cr
    2&\dfrac{b-b(a-b)^t}{1-a+b}&\dfrac{(1-a)+b(a-b)^t}{1-a+b}}
\end{equation}

\end{document}
Remarks: 1) Please provide complete, minimal code in your posts.
2) It seems that you want to cross-reference the posted formula; if this is so, change \[...\] to \begin{equation}...\end{equation} (as I did in my example); the explanation is simple: \[...\] doesn't produce any numbering, so using \label inside \[...\] will pick the wrong string to produce the reference.
